Bryant offers a variety of air conditioning systems that range from 13 SEER all the way up to 20 SEER for efficiency ranges. In Bryants lower efficiency ranges Bryant also offers equipment with the old refrigerant R-22 while maintaining a full line of air conditioners that use R-410A or the newer ozone friendly refrigerant. Bryant offers four distinct lines of air conditioners: The Evolution Series which is Bryant top of the line models –, The Preferred Series which is Bryants premium quality air conditioners –, The Preferred Compact series which is a premium product in smaller package –, and the Legacy series of products which is the economical offering of Bryant air conditioning. Some features of Bryant air conditioners are:

  • Models range into the 20 SEER efficiency levels for selected Bryant air conditioners
  • Selected Bryant air conditioners have two-stage operation for air conditioning and heating. Two-stage scroll compressors
  • Bryant air conditioners are engineered to be quiet
  • Electronic diagnostics available on selected Bryant systems for easier air conditioner troubleshooting
  • Powder coating paint on air conditioning units prevent rust and corossion
  • Galvanized steel construction for durability of cabinet

Bryant was founded in 1904 by Charles Bryant offering gas fired boilers. Bryant is now owned by United Technologies which is also the parent company of Carrier.
